Opportunity
On behalf of a Connacht Region University Hospital in Ireland, Head Medical are seeking a dedicated and experienced Consultant in ENT (Otolaryngology) to join their dynamic and growing medical team. This is an excellent opportunity to work in a leading hospital, providing high-quality patient care while contributing to the development of innovative medical practices in a supportive and progressive environment.
This role is not a substantive post but will be a relatively long contract of 12 months with a view of going permanent.
What’s on Offer for You?
- Basic Salary scale between €231,215- €277,736 in accordance with the HSE 2023 Consultant contract
- Additional remuneration for on-call duties and overtime as applicable depending on rota (up to €19,000)
- Highly flexible contract that enables consultants opportunity for a variety of different work patterns
- Up to €12,000 CME and €8,000 research grant
- 30 days annual leave
- 10 public holidays
- Continuous Medical Education leave
- Hours: 37 hours per week, plus on-call supplements
